From 6a208294bef44f588e067383aa2e35af1aa23a16 Mon Sep 17 00:00:00 2001 From: Klaus Schmidinger Date: Sun, 6 Dec 2009 12:57:45 +0100 Subject: Several code modifications to avoid compiler warnings --- libsi/si.c | 3 ++- libsi/si.h | 4 +++- 2 files changed, 5 insertions(+), 2 deletions(-) (limited to 'libsi') diff --git a/libsi/si.c b/libsi/si.c index 49464baf..01ab9bf2 100644 --- a/libsi/si.c +++ b/libsi/si.c @@ -6,7 +6,7 @@ * the Free Software Foundation; either version 2 of the License, or * * (at your option) any later version. * * * - * $Id: si.c 1.25 2008/03/05 17:00:55 kls Exp $ + * $Id: si.c 2.1 2009/12/05 16:20:12 kls Exp $ * * ***************************************************************************/ @@ -720,6 +720,7 @@ Descriptor *Descriptor::getDescriptor(CharArray da, DescriptorTagDomain domain, break; } break; + default: ; // unknown domain, nothing to do } d->setData(da); return d; diff --git a/libsi/si.h b/libsi/si.h index 9d47d306..b28b14ab 100644 --- a/libsi/si.h +++ b/libsi/si.h @@ -6,7 +6,7 @@ * the Free Software Foundation; either version 2 of the License, or * * (at your option) any later version. * * * - * $Id: si.h 2.1 2008/09/06 12:44:06 kls Exp $ + * $Id: si.h 2.2 2009/12/06 11:37:35 kls Exp $ * * ***************************************************************************/ @@ -411,6 +411,8 @@ public: return data.FourBytes(index); case 8: return (SixtyFourBit(data.FourBytes(index)) << 32) | data.FourBytes(index+4); + default: + return 0; // just to avoid a compiler warning } return 0; // just to avoid a compiler warning } -- cgit v1.2.3